The Integra family of hot plates was designed to provide an affordable yet
reliable approach to conductive thermal testing. They not only offer the lowest
purchase cost but the high quality construction assures the lowest cost of
ownership.
These hot plates are the quickest and most economical approach to testing
electronic components. They are much faster than chambers and interconnecting
and tuning of the unit under test is easy.
The Integra is heated by cartridge elements embedded in the plate. It is
cooled by the expansion of liquid Carbon Dioxide (LCO2) or Liquid Nitrogen (LN2)
in an extremely efficient channel hermetically sealed within the plate. Two
standard sizes are available (6.75" x 6.75" and 11" x 11").
The plates are surface ground for flatness and hard plated for durability.
A microprocessor-based digital indicating temperature controller is
integrated within the hot plate chassis, making for a compact design. The
controller has a dual LED display showing both desired temperature and current
set point. The thermal ramp rate can be set via a front panel.
Two different remote communication options are available. Factory or field
installable RS-232/485 serial interface or an external IEEE-488 GPIB interface
can be supplied.
A latching failsafe is included in the hotplate to guard against thermal
runaway. The plates come in a choice of 115VAC or 230VAC input.
